Tom Gates books are perfect for kids ages 9 and up. Tom Gates’ illustrated his life and shares his wide imagination through creative drawings. The exaggerated words in a flurry of fonts, and BRILLIANT doodles(!) makes these fiction books a unique, accessible read. Tom Gates has dyslexia, just like his creator Liz Pichon. This gives kids with learning difficulties a boost of confidence, and supports access to the enjoyment of reading. British author and illustrator Liz Pichon began her career as a graphic design artist creating cover art for a music label. As her art style developed, she began selling prints on a wide range of products. In 2004, she published her first book both written and illustrated herself called Square Eyed Pat. She has since published several other books outside of the Tom Gates series. Pichon has no plans to stop creating Tom Gates books, nor other books! Her latest book outside of the Gates series is called Shoe Wars, published in 2020, and features a large cast of hilarious characters.

Readers are introduced to Tom’s best mate Derek, who is also his neighbour, and band mate in the cool band Dog Zombies! We meet Tom’s grumpy older sister Delia, who is on the receiving end of a lot of Tom’s cheeky and audacious pranks. Not forgetting Tom’s annoying arch enemy - Marcus, who he has to sit next to everyday in class… Tom navigates all the ups and downs of growing up, making friends, getting through school and avoiding as much homework as possible! Doodling on his plaster cast helps to pass the time, along with visits from family (with treats), friends and even Rooster managing to sneak in. Tom remembers other fun times he's had, like metal detecting with Uncle Kevin and the cousins or inventing a new secret language with Derek. With a short run, the producers of Horrible Histories and Gangsta Granny brought the characters to life and toured the UK. As well as the main series, Liz Pichon has also published other books in the Tom Gates universe. From a music book with real grade 1 notations for music exams, to a big activity book, there’s so much to get kids engaged. Author Liz Pichon regularly tours with events like ‘How to draw like Tom Gates’ where children (and grown ups!) can practice their best doodles with the creator herself.
